Grand Park's New Year's Eve LA

If your looking for a party that won't brake your bank, downtown L.A.'s Grand Park throws a pretty epic bash every year—and the best part it's FREE. They'll have three music stages with local acts like Mr Little Jeans and Breakestra, and KCRW DJs like Garth Trinidad and Chris Douridas spinning on the ones and twos. Over 30 food vendors will be whipping up goodies so you won't have to go hungry while you stay out all night. There will be 3D video projection mapping over the 22-story City Hall as the countdown to midnight takes place, and you can snap some pictures with your besties in a photo booth at the event. If you take the Metro Red Line or Purple Line, ride for free and get off at Civic Center/Grand Park Station at the 1st Street exit, or the Gold Line at Union Station. There's also a free bike valet at at Hill and Second St. The event runs from 7:00 p.m. to 12:30 a.m. However, keep in mind that this is an alcohol-free event, so you'll have to pre-party and leave your booze at home.

Grand Park is located at 210 North Grand Avenue, downtown

Let's Party NYE At Park Plaza Hotel

Over at Westlake's Legendary Park Plaza hotel is an all-out indie dance party hosted by KCRW, A-OK AND IAMSOUND. Blood Orange will be headlining and debuting new material and Classixx will be performing live at this event. There will a bevy of other acts (including Blake Anderson from Comedy Central's Workaholics DJing) on the three stages from 8 p.m. to 3 a.m. A general admission ticket for $125 gets you in with an open bar all night.

Legendary Park Plaza hotel is located at 607 South Park View Street, Westlake, (213) 381-6300

NYE143

Named after the popular '90s pager code for "I Love You," 143 is a super-sweaty dance party for the jamster crowd. R&B, slow jams, hip-hop, and '90s house on the decks from DJs Sosupersam, Them Jeans, Siik, Kronika, Dan Oh, Bobby Evans. Champagne toast and countdown. Open bar and table reservations also available. Get your dancing shoes ready!

Los Globos is located at 3040 W. Sunset Blvd., Silver Lake. More info

Rhondapolis NYE 2015

If you haven't been to any A Club Called Rhonda dance parties, you're missing out. It's the type of place where you can be you. According to the website, "Rhondapolis serves as the global center for self-expression so anything goes, as long as it’s fabulous!" This year, they're throwing a rager at downtown L.A.'s The Standard hotel from 9 p.m. to 4 a.m., with four stages featuring some sweet artists like Hot Chip, Etienne De Crecy and Peanut Butter Wolf. The general admission ticket comes with an open bar, and you won't have to tip. There's also champagne that will be served at midnight for the toast. The cheaper early bird tickets have already sold out, but $175 ones are still available.

The Standard is located at 550 South Flower, downtown

And if your itching to jump start a stay-cation for 2015, head on over to the ACE Hotel in Palm Springs:

The Commune at the ACE Hotel will be having a party that we'd actually consider trekking out for. Hosted by Spaceland and Moon Block Party, they'll be ringing in the new year with great acts like Fool's Gold, Deap Vally and Crystal Skulls. DJs will spinning as well throughout the night. Tickets are $25 if you buy them online, and $30 at the door if there are any left. With that admission, you'll also get a champagne toast at midnight. If you'd like to purchase food or drinks, that will be available at the event. Doors open at 8 p.m., with music starting at 9 p.m.

ACE Hotel is located at 701 E. Palm Canyon Dr., Palm Springs, (760) 325-9900
